Agreements Overview
ADNOC and Gecko Robotics have signed three agreements to enhance the use of robotics and artificial intelligence (AI) in ADNOC's operations. These agreements aim to improve efficiency, reduce downtime, and support data-driven maintenance across ADNOC's energy assets.
AIQ and Cantilever System
AIQ, a joint venture between ADNOC and Presight, has entered a multi-year partnership with Gecko Robotics to deploy the Cantilever operating system across ADNOC Gas' assets. This marks AIQ's entry into the field of robotics.
Robotics and AI Deployment
ADNOC and Gecko Robotics will explore the broader deployment of advanced robotics and AI-powered analytics. This includes the potential manufacturing of robotic systems within the UAE and the application of AI solutions to meet ADNOC's operational needs.
Training Collaboration
The third agreement involves collaboration between Gecko Robotics and the ADNOC Technical Academy (ATA) to develop training programs for UAE Nationals. This initiative aims to boost future skills in advanced technologies.
